Aetsveld-Zuid, Amsterdam
NeighbourhoodThis apartment on Reigersweide sits on the outskirts of Weesp, where the street ends in meadows and there is no through traffic. The listing does not state an energy label. As a result, the energy efficiency of this home is unknown. At €299,500 for 51 m², the price is in line with the market for apartments in Amsterdam.
The neighbourhood Aetsveld-Zuid is a quiet residential area with a mix of families and older residents. One resident says: "Because we are on the outskirts, there is no through traffic. In the middle of the street a large playground with a table tennis table and a small football pitch. And playground equipment. Behind our house only meadows." The neighbourhood Aetsveld-Zuid has a high proportion of families and owner-occupied homes, giving it a settled feel.
For daily shopping, the SPAR is just around the corner, and the Vomar and Albert Heijn are a ten-minute walk away. Basisschool Wisperweide is a couple of streets away, and the Casparus College for secondary education is about a ten-minute walk. The municipality Amsterdam offers all the amenities of a major city, yet here you are surrounded by green.

About Reigersweide 119, Weesp
At 51 m², the price works out to about €5,873 per m², which is typical for apartments in Weesp. The home is in a quiet street with no through traffic, and the neighbourhood is well regarded. Without an energy label, you cannot factor in energy costs, but the asking price itself is in line with the local market.
Aetsveld-Zuid is a quiet, family-oriented neighbourhood on the edge of Weesp. There is no through traffic, and the street has a large playground with table tennis, a football pitch, and playground equipment. Behind the houses are meadows. The area has a mix of families and older residents, and most homes are owner-occupied.
Weesp train station is 2.2 km away, which is about a 25-minute walk or a short cycle ride. From there you can reach Amsterdam Central in about 15 minutes.
The SPAR supermarket is just around the corner (232 m). The Vomar and Albert Heijn are about a ten-minute walk. Basisschool Wisperweide is a couple of streets away (286 m), and the Casparus College for secondary education is about 1 km away.
The agent has not provided an energy label for this listing.
The listing does not mention a garden, balcony, or terrace. The plot size is not given, so it is unclear whether there is any private outdoor space. The street does have a large playground and meadows behind the houses.
